macOS: right-click the app, choose Open, then confirm. Or System Settings > Privacy & Security > Open Anyway.
Windows: if SmartScreen appears, click "More info", then "Run anyway".
Linux: install the .deb from a terminal with sudo dpkg -i write-a-lot_0.1.0_amd64.deb (a graphical installer may refuse a local file). For the AppImage, chmod +x it and run.
